More Bad News For Quinton “Rampage” Jackson, Accident Victim Suffers Miscarriage

Quinton "Rampage" Jackson was arrested not too long ago due to a hit and run incident.  Rampage was in a car accident in Newport beach, but fled the scene and hit a few cars while the cops were chasing him down.  With much support from Dana White and many other of Rampage’s friends, the former UFC light heavyweight champ was able to surpass such a tragic moment in his life.

However, we were informed that one of the victims that was injured during the incident would later acquire a miscarriage.  This can only mean more bad news for Rampage as he was finally recuperating from the whole mess. 

Here are the details we were able to gather up (props to the Daily Pilot):

Huntington Beach woman who was more than 16 weeks pregnant and who police said was injured in a hit-and-run crash with mixed martial artist Quinton “Rampage” Jackson on the 55 Freeway two weeks ago has had a miscarriage, her fiance said Friday.

Holli Griggs, 38, was driving her 2007 Cadillac Escalade in the left lane on the southbound 55 Freeway just south of Bay Street on July 15 when Jackson’s gray-and-green pick-up truck sideswiped her as he drove along the median lane at about 45 mph, California Highway Patrol officials said.

Prosecutors have yet to file charges against Jackson, a former light heavyweight champion for the Ultimate Fighting Championship who remains free on $25,000 bail. Prosecutors would not comment on any potential charges due to Griggs’ miscarriage…

The couple have retained an attorney but have yet to take legal action against Jackson.“No amount of money will bring back my son,” Krebs said outside his home Thursday.
